About Enze Xu
Enze Xu is a scholar working on Catalysis, Process Chemistry and Technology and Materials Chemistry, having authored 57 papers that have together received 1.9k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advancements in Battery Materials (13 papers), Perovskite Materials and Applications (12 papers) and Advanced Battery Materials and Technologies (11 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Materials Chemistry (1.0k citations), Electrical and Electronic Engineering (1.2k citations) and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(308 citations). Enze Xu has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Austria. Frequent co-authors include Yang Jiang, Zhifeng Zhu, Guoqing Tong, Junjie Quan, Hui Wang, Yajing Chang, Yusen Yang, Min Wei, Danting Li and Dabin Yu. Their work appears in journals such as Advanced Materials, Angewandte Chemie International Edition and Langmuir.
